This is interesting to see, however the chair was designed with ergonomics at heart, which is why there is no headrest, when you sit in the chair it supports correct posture, whic is why there are different size of chairs and adjustability, in in turn means that the head does not need to be supported, adding a head reast defeats the purpose and also may lead to poor posture.
